The global Carbohydrate Antigen 19 9 (CA 19-9) market size was valued at approximately USD 450 million in 2025 and is projected to reach USD 765 million by 2035, growing at a CAGR of 5.5% during the forecast period. The CA 19-9 market encompasses the production, distribution, and application of the carbohydrate antigen used primarily as a tumor marker in clinical practice, particularly in detecting and managing gastrointestinal cancers. The market ecosystem includes diagnostic centers, hospitals, clinical laboratories, research organizations, and key stakeholders such as healthcare providers, pharmaceutical companies, and regulatory bodies. Its role in cancer diagnostics and management, along with its widespread adoption in healthcare applications, signifies its strategic importance in the healthcare sector.

In North America, the market commands the highest share owing to advanced healthcare infrastructure and high cancer incidence rates. Europe follows closely, driven by stringent regulatory standards and a strong focus on sustainable healthcare solutions. Asia Pacific, while ranking third, displays the fastest growth potential, aided by rising healthcare investments and manufacturing advantages. Latin America's market presents emerging opportunities, although it's still developing compared to other regions, while the Middle East & Africa, with minimal market share, is yet to accelerate its development.
The CA 19-9 market is moderately consolidated with major players like Roche Diagnostics, Abbott Laboratories, and Siemens Healthineers leading through extensive product portfolios and regional presences.
